๐ Where is Thung Makham Noi Pier?
Thung Makham Noi Pier is located about 20 km south of Chumphon town, on the Gulf of Thailand coast. It’s the primary departure point for Lomprayah high-speed ferries heading to Koh Tao, Koh Phangan, and Koh Samui.
- Google Maps keyword: “Thung Makham Noi Pier”
- Nearest town: Chumphon
- Getting there: Taxi, van, or shuttle service from Chumphon train station or airport
๐ณ๏ธ Ferry Services from the Pier
Lomprayah is the main operator at Thung Makham Noi. Their high-speed catamarans are known for punctuality, safety, and comfort. Ferries run daily and connect directly to:
- ๐๏ธ Koh Tao (Mae Haad Pier) โ approx. 1 hr 45 min
- ๐๏ธ Koh Phangan โ approx. 3 hrs
- ๐๏ธ Koh Samui โ approx. 4 hrs

๐งณ What to Expect at the Pier
- A simple, well-organized terminal with basic facilities (toilets, ticket counter, snacks , restarant and cafe)
- Staff help load/unload luggage
- Nearby cafes and waiting areas available
- ATM and convenience stores are a few minutes away by car


โ Why Choose Thung Makham Noi Pier?
- ๐ Faster route to Koh Tao than coming from Surat Thani
- ๐งโโ๏ธ Less crowded than Donsak or Nathon piers
- ๐ธ Budget-friendly options with combo tickets from Bangkok or Chumphon


๐ก Travel Tips
- Book your ferry ticket in advance, especially in high season (DecโApril, JulyโAug)
- Motion sickness pills are recommended if you’re sensitive to waves
- Combine your journey with an overnight train from Bangkok for a smooth travel experience
